How to Use: A Mini-Tutorial
Creating a Spiral Column Rebar:
- Draw a cylinder (your column core).
- Click the Toh icon: "Helical / Spiral Rebar."
- Select the top face of the cylinder.
- Input your pitch (spacing) – e.g., 100mm.
- Input your bar diameter – e.g., 12mm.
- Click "Generate."
- Result: A perfect 3D spiral rebar appears instantly, wrapping around your column.
Adding Stirrups to a Beam:
- Select the beam group.
- Click "Beam Stirrups."
- Choose the cover distance (concrete cover).
- V120 automatically calculates the inner perimeter and places square ties at every interval you set.

Workflow: From Concrete to Steel
To truly appreciate the value of TOH Rebars V120, let’s walk through a typical workflow of a user who has downloaded this extension:
Step 1: The Host Geometry The user models a standard concrete column or beam using standard SketchUp tools. The geometry acts as the "host."
Step 2: Defining the Section Using the TOH Rebars toolbar, the user clicks on the face of the concrete section. A dialog box appears, allowing them to define the "Rebar Set."
Step 3: Inputting Parameters Here is where the magic happens. The user inputs:
- Bar Diameter: (e.g., 12mm, 16mm, 20mm)
- Concrete Cover: (e.g., 25mm, 40mm)
- Spacing: (e.g., 150mm c/c)
- Hook Type: (90-degree, 135-degree, etc.)
